Treating Hot Spots on Your Pet Dog



You must see your vet for an exam as soon as you discover any irregularity in your pet dog’s skin, or if your pet starts to excessively scratch, lick and/or chew areas on his hair. Your vet will certainly try to figure out the cause of hot spots. Whether it is a flea allergic reaction, an anal gland infection or anxiety, the underlying problem needs to be taken care of. Your vet will suggest the care as well as medications needed to make your canine extra comfortable and enable the hot spots on your dogs to go away. This may consist of the use of an Elizabethan collar to maintain your pet from licking as well as chewing existing sores.

Treatment might additionally include the following:

  • Removing the hair surrounding the lesion, which allows air and medication to reach the injury
  • Cleaning the hot spot with a non-irritating solution
  • Anti-biotics as well as pain relievers
  • Medication to avoid and treat parasites
  • Well balanced diet plan to assist maintain healthy skin as well as coat
  • Nutritional supplement including necessary fatty acids
  • Antihistamines or corticosteroids to manage itching
  • Hypoallergenic diet plan for food allergic reactions
Preventing Locations
  • Make certain your pet is groomed regularly, as well as you may choose to maintain your family pet’s hair clipped short, particularly during warmer months.
  • Follow a rigorous flea control program as advised by your vet.
  • To maintain boredom and stress at bay, make sure your pet gets ample exercise as well as play with his human family or canine pals.

Tips for Pet Owners in Niagara Falls ON with Their Pet’s Skin Problems

Since your dog’s skin is a reflection of her general health, it’s important to keep it in good form. When your pet dog has a skin problem, he or she might scratch, chew, and/or lick excessively. External parasites, infections, allergic reactions, metabolic disorders, and stress, along with a mix of these, could be to fault.

In order to learn more visit by clicking on, skin problems on your dogs or read below.




Inspect your pet’s ears and teeth initially, as these are regularly the source of germs that trigger odour in pets. Keeping your dog clean by bathing him regularly may be all that is required to remove the odour.

When utilized as per the directions on the package, most pet perfumes are not likely to be hazardous to your family pet. Pets with dermal allergic reactions, on the other hand, may have skin pain, while those with nasal allergies might be affected by the smell. If you wish to utilize pooch perfume, follow the instructions carefully and consult a veterinarian if your pet dog has a history of allergic reactions.

Please talk to your veterinarian if grooming proves useless and your pet smells foul, to determine if there is any reason to develop a disease or a cause.

Other skin problems on your pet include:

  • Drainage of blood or pus
  • Dry, flaky or otherwise inflamed skin
  • Loss of hair, bald patches
  • Hot spots (one particular area where itching is extreme)
  • Lesions
  • Rashes
  • Soreness or inflammation
  • Round, flaky patches on the face and paws
  • Rubbing face against furnishings or carpeting
  • Scabs
  • Scratching, licking or chewing at skin
  • Swellings, bumps or skin staining

Tips on Dental Care for Pet Owners in Niagara Falls ON

Regularly brushing your pet’s teeth, along with a healthy diet and plenty of chew toys, can go a long way towards keeping her mouth healthy. Germs and plaque-forming foods can trigger accumulation on a canine’s teeth. This can harden into tartar, possibly triggering gingivitis, receding gums and tooth loss. Numerous pooches show indications of gum illness by the time they’re four years of ages because they aren’t offered with proper mouth care.

Give your dog regular home checks and you’ll have an extremely satisfied pooch with a dazzling smile. We suggest brushing two to three times a week.

First, you’ll want to get your family pet used to the concept of having thier teeth brushed. To do this, start by carefully rubbing her lips with your finger in a circling motion for 30 to 60 seconds once or twice a day for a couple of weeks before moving on to his teeth and gums.

After a few sessions or when your pooch appears comfortable, put a little bit of dog-formulated tooth paste on her lips to get her utilized to the taste.

Picking Toothpaste for Pet Dogs

Do not utilize human tooth paste, which can aggravate a pet dog’s stomach. Instead, ask your veterinarian for tooth paste made especially for dogs or make a paste out of baking soda and water.




Common Eye Issues in Canines

The following eye-related conditions are typically seen in pets:

Dry Eye: Damaged tear production can cause inflammation, discharge, and squinting.

Cataract: Opacity on the eye which can trigger reduced vision and potential loss of sight.

Conjunctivitis: One or both eyes are swollen and red with potential discharge.

Recognizing an Ear Infection in Canines

It can be hard for caught up debris or water inside a canine’s ear to be launched, making it quite easy for pet dogs to get ear diseases. Ensure you are regularly examining your pet dog’s ears for odor, swelling, discharge or any other signs of infection. Visit your veterinarian as quickly as you can if your dog has any of the signs revealed below.

  • Ear scratching
  • Ear swelling
  • Ear smell
  • Discharge that is brown, yellow or bloody
  • Crusted or scabby skin surrounding the ear flap
  • Loss of hair around the ear
  • Inflammation surrounding ear
  • Loss of balance
  • Loss of hearing
  • Wiping their ear on the ground
  • Uncommon head shaking or head tilt
  • Strolling in circles




Helping Dogs with Delicate Feet

A lot of canine’s can’t stand getting their feet and nails touched, so it’s advised to get your canine used to it prior to clipping their nails (ideally, beginning when they are a puppy). Rub your hand up and down their leg and carefully push down on each and every toe. Do not forget to provide lots of appreciation and even treats. Doing this everyday for a week will have them feeling more relaxed when they get their nails cut. Another excellent tip is tiring your dog out prior to beginning the nail cutting.

Tips on Paw Care for Dog Parents in Niagara Falls ON

The pads on the soles of your pet dog’s feet give additional cushioning to protect their bones from trauma, provide insulation, help walking, and protect tissue within their paw. It has several crucial functions so it’s crucial to check your pet’s feet regularly and make sure they’re devoid of wounds, infections or foreign things that get stuck.

To make certain they’re in great condition, keep an eye out for particles, dirt, pebbles, and even little bits of damaged glass. If you discover any splinters or debris, remove them gently with tweezers. Next, you need to trim the hair and comb in between their toes, making sure it’s even to prevent any agonizing matting.
